发明名称 Eye diagram analyzer with fixed data channel delays and swept clock channel delay
摘要 Delay induced apparent amplitude desensitization in a data signal channel and its accompanying worm-like distortion in an Eye Diagram Analyzer is avoided by altering the measurement to avoid the need for any substantial delay in the path of the data channel threshold comparison signals. In a first technique, only enough delay will be inserted in the data channels to produce the relative adjustments needed to compensate for skew between the data channels, as determined by a calibration operation, and it is these de-skewed, but otherwise un-delayed, data threshold comparison signals that are, in rapid succession, clocked into the latches whose difference registers a hit at a given (time, voltage) pair. The clock path delay is then varied from a minimal value to a sufficiently large value capable of spanning a desired the number of eye diagram cycles. In a second technique, the needed amounts of de-skew delay found by the calibration operation are noted, and then the actual delays in the data path are set back to zero. The clock path delay is swept as in the first technique. The de-skewing operation is then performed in post-processing that produces the eye diagram after the measurement is complete. In either technique, the short width of transitions in the data threshold comparison signals that are associated with threshold values near the extremes of data signal excursion are no longer swallowed by the finite bandwidth of a long delay line, since the delay lines in the data channel paths now either introduce only just enough delay to compensate for skew (and those amounts are very short), or, do not introduce any extra delay at all.
